ajooter:
What's piking?

Offline ajooter

  • Member
  • Posts: 1,203
Re: 2016 Primitive Archer Bow Trade Sign up and Information
« Reply #3545 on: July 22, 2016, 08:25:23 am »
Piking is shortening the bow from either end.  That will in turn up the draw weight.

Whats are your thoughts on piking vs heat treating?...think i should heat treat first and then pike or vice versa?

A proper heat temper should up your weight by at least 10#. I would leave the length alone until you see what tempering gives you. Looks like your top limb is still heavier and the bow looks tipped forward in your hand, but that's just a pic, I cant feel it from here :)
